Battery Charging Dos and Do n'ts

When it involves billing lithium batteries, it is vital to follow certain dos and do n'ts to guarantee ideal performance and longevity. The first bottom line to consider is using the proper charger for your specific lithium battery. Making use of a battery charger that is not made for lithium batteries can lead to overcharging, which can lead to reduced battery life and possibly hazardous scenarios. It is additionally crucial to avoid billing your lithium battery at extreme temperatures. Billing at temperature levels below cold or above 140 ° F(60 ° C) can trigger irreversible damages to the battery, minimizing its ability and overall life-span. Furthermore, it is crucial to prevent overcharging your lithium battery. Overcharging can generate warm and cause the battery to swell or perhaps blow up. To stop overcharging, it is suggested to use a charger with a built-in overcharge defense feature or a smart charger that immediately stops billing when the battery is totally billed. Finally, it is recommended to charge your lithium battery in a well-ventilated area to dissipate any type of heat produced throughout the charging process. By following these dos and do n'ts, you can guarantee the optimal efficiency and long life of your lithium batteries.

Ideal Battery Storage Practices

To make certain the longevity and ideal efficiency of lithium batteries, it is critical to comply with appropriate storage space techniques. When not in use, lithium batteries should be stored in a great, dry location with temperatures ranging between 15-25 levels Celsius.



Furthermore, it is essential to keep lithium batteries in a stable and safe and secure setting to stop physical damages. Avoid keeping them in position where they can be conveniently dropped or subjected to too much resonance. In addition, it is suggested to store lithium batteries in their original packaging or in a safety instance to reduce the threat of unintended short circuits.

On a regular basis evaluate the batteries for any indications of swelling, leakage, or damages. If any one of these issues are discovered, do not save the battery or make use of and get rid of it properly according to local regulations.

Efficient Battery Use Habits

Correct storage methods are crucial for maintaining the longevity and ideal efficiency of lithium batteries; now, allow's check out effective battery use habits. To begin, it is vital to avoid overcharging your lithium battery.

Additionally, it is essential to avoid entirely discharging your lithium battery. Unlike older battery modern technologies, lithium batteries do not take advantage of being completely discharged. Deep discharging can trigger irreparable damages to the battery, reducing its capability over time. It is best to charge the battery when it reaches around 20% to 30% of its remaining capacity.

Furthermore, it is suggested to maintain modest temperature level problems for your lithium battery. Extreme temperature levels, both cold and hot, can negatively influence the battery's performance and life-span. It is advised to make use of the battery and save within a temperature level variety of 20 ° C to 25 ° C(68 ° F to 77 ° F) for optimum performance.Lastly, it is vital to deal with lithium batteries with care, avoiding any physical damage or exposure to wetness. Going down, crushing, or piercing the battery can bring about interior damage and potential safety risks. In addition, moisture can rust the battery's components and compromise its efficiency.

Advanced Battery Management Strategies

Carrying out innovative battery monitoring techniques is crucial for enhancing the performance and life expectancy of lithium batteries (lithium battery manufacturers). These strategies exceed fundamental battery usage behaviors and include advanced strategies to make certain the reliable procedure of lithium batteries

One crucial technique is temperature management. Operating lithium batteries at extreme temperature levels can dramatically minimize their efficiency and life-span. For that reason, it is necessary to keep an eye on and regulate the temperature level of the batteries to keep them within the optimal variety. This can be achieved through thermal administration systems that control the battery's temperature level throughout charging, discharging, and storage space.

An additional strategy is state of cost (SOC) administration. Keeping the battery within a recommended SOC array helps to lengthen its lifespan. Overcharging or deep discharging a lithium battery can cause permanent damage. By executing innovative SOC management techniques, such as using innovative battery administration systems (BMS), it is possible to avoid these unwanted problems and extend the battery's life.

Moreover, executing innovative charge control formulas can boost the billing efficiency of lithium batteries. These formulas guarantee that the battery is billed at the optimum rate and voltage, lowering billing time and lessening power losses.
